.\" Automatically generated by Pandoc 3.1.11.1 .\" .TH "ALLEGRO_FS_INTERFACE" "3" "" "Allegro reference manual" "" .SH NAME ALLEGRO_FS_INTERFACE \- Allegro 5 API .SH SYNOPSIS .IP .EX #include typedef struct ALLEGRO_FS_INTERFACE ALLEGRO_FS_INTERFACE; .EE .SH DESCRIPTION The available functions you can provide for a filesystem. They are: .IP .EX ALLEGRO_FS_ENTRY * fs_create_entry (const char *path); void fs_destroy_entry (ALLEGRO_FS_ENTRY *e); const char * fs_entry_name (ALLEGRO_FS_ENTRY *e); bool fs_update_entry (ALLEGRO_FS_ENTRY *e); uint32_t fs_entry_mode (ALLEGRO_FS_ENTRY *e); time_t fs_entry_atime (ALLEGRO_FS_ENTRY *e); time_t fs_entry_mtime (ALLEGRO_FS_ENTRY *e); time_t fs_entry_ctime (ALLEGRO_FS_ENTRY *e); off_t fs_entry_size (ALLEGRO_FS_ENTRY *e); bool fs_entry_exists (ALLEGRO_FS_ENTRY *e); bool fs_remove_entry (ALLEGRO_FS_ENTRY *e); bool fs_open_directory (ALLEGRO_FS_ENTRY *e); ALLEGRO_FS_ENTRY * fs_read_directory (ALLEGRO_FS_ENTRY *e); bool fs_close_directory(ALLEGRO_FS_ENTRY *e); bool fs_filename_exists(const char *path); bool fs_remove_filename(const char *path); char * fs_get_current_directory(void); bool fs_change_directory(const char *path); bool fs_make_directory(const char *path); ALLEGRO_FILE * fs_open_file(ALLEGRO_FS_ENTRY *e); .EE
